A Legacy Woven in Cloth: The Allure of Vintage Gucci Jackie Bags
The Gucci Jackie bag, originally launched in the 1960s under the name "Constance," was rebranded and catapulted to global fame after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is was frequently photographed carrying it. This association cemented its place in fashion history, transforming it from a stylish handbag into a coveted status symbol. While leather versions dominate the conversation, the vintage cloth Gucci Jackie bags offer a different kind of charm. Often crafted from durable canvas, these bags boast a unique texture and a more casual, yet still undeniably chic, aesthetic. Their vintage appeal lies not only in their age but also in the subtle variations in design and materials found across different eras and production runs.
